Coming to Pra Loup by plane

Marseille airport:

From Marseille Provence airport, several solutions are available to you to reach Barcelonnette and then Pra Loup. On Fridays, Saturdays and Sundays, during the February holiday periods, you can take the Navette Blanche 50, for example.

On weekdays, a convenient route is to first reach the Aix-en-Provence bus station on board the Le Car A2 bus. From there, you continue your journey with the Zou! Express 69 to the Aéropôle stop in Tallard. Finally, you get into the Zou! Proximity 535 in the direction of Barcelonnette, with a finish at Place Aimé Gassier.

Arrival is usually in the early afternoon, depending on traffic and the time of year. Once there, all you have to do is take one of the free shuttles to reach the Pra Loup resort.

Nice airport:

From Nice Airport, it is possible to reach Barcelonnette and then Pra Loup by combining bus and connections to Marseille.

A first option is to walk to the airport bus station (Terminal 1), then take a Blablabus in the direction of Marseille – Gare Saint-Charles. Once you arrive in Marseille, simply go to the Gare Saint-Charles stop to take the Le Car A1 bus to Marseille Provence airport (Marignane). From the airport bus station, you continue your journey with the Zou! Express 50 in the direction of the Ubaye valley, to Barcelonnette – Place Aimé Gassier.

Another option is to reach Nice Saint-Augustin train station from the airport and then take a train Zou! TER in the direction of Marseille Saint-Charles. When you arrive, you will take the Le Car A1 bus to Marseille Provence airport. From there, the link continues with the Zou! Express 50 to Barcelonnette.

Please note: line 50 (Navettes Blanches) runs mainly on Saturdays and Sundays during the school holidays, and on some Fridays in February. Outside these dates, you must take the regular lines:

  • line 68, which can reach Barcelonnette directly,
    or
  • lines 68 or 69, with a connection at Tallard (Aéropôle) and then take line 535 towards Barcelonnette.

In any case, the finish is in the heart of Barcelonnette. Then simply take one of the free shuttles to Pra Loup resort.

Coming to Pra Loup by train

Take the train to Aix TGV station.

You have two options:

Take a Zou bus to get to Pra Loup resort

Rent a car

The train is a great option to reach the Alps while enjoying the journey.
The closest train stations to Pra Loup are Gap and Aix, both of which are well served by regional and national lines. From the station, bus or shuttle connections allow you to reach Barcelonnette, then the resort of Pra Loup.

In winter and summer, some connections are suitable for weekend arrivals and departures, ideal for short stays.

Tip : Allow enough time for a connection between your train and bus, especially during busy periods or in winter weather conditions.
